What is Gene Therapy?
Genetic intervention is a clinical treatment that focuses on altering a person’s hereditary blueprint to treat or prevent illness. This is executed through diverse methods, including:
Gene Insertion Therapy – Integrating a corrected DNA sequence to substitute a mutated or absent unit.
Gene Knockdown – Halting the function of unwanted mutated segments. Targeted DNA Editing – Accurately editing the genome using advanced tools like programmable nucleases. Therapeutic Cell Alteration – Reprogramming organic tissues in laboratory settings and reintroducing them into the patient.

Viral Vectors
Microbes have developed to effectively introduce genetic material into target cells, establishing them as a viable method for gene therapy. Widely used virus-based carriers feature:
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both dividing and non-dividing cells but can elicit immunogenic reactions.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their lower immunogenicity and potential to ensure extended DNA transcription.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Embed within the host genome,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, diminishing adverse immunogenic effects.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for targeted internalization.
Electroporation –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in plasma barriers, allowing genetic material to enter.
Targeted Genetic Infusion –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into localized cells.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ders
Many genetic disorders originate in single-gene mutations, making them ideal candidates for genetic correction. Key developments include: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Studies focusing on delivering corrective chloride channel genes are showing promising results.
Hemophilia – DNA treatment experiments focus on regenerating the generation of hemostatic molecules.
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-driven genetic correction del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.
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.
DNA-Based Oncology Solutions
Genetic modification is integral in oncology, either by modifying immune cells to target malignant cells or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to suppress proliferation. Some of the most promising t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:
C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ells focusing on malignancy-associated proteins.
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Engineered viruses that exclusively invade and eliminate malignant tissues.
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Reestablishing the efficacy of genes like TP53 to control proliferation.
Therapy of Communicable Conditions
Genomic medicine introduces prospective cures for persistent syndromes including HIV. Investigative modalities comprise:
Gene-editing HIV Therapy – Directing towards and eliminating HIV-infected units.
Genetic Modification of Lymphocytes – Programming Helper cells resistant to pathogen infiltration.

Gene Therapy: Restructuring the Molecular Structure
Gene therapy functions through altering the core defect of chromosomal abnormalities:
In Vivo Gene Therapy: Injects genetic instructions directly into the organism, like the clinically endorsed Luxturna for curing hereditary ocular disorders.
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Requires adjusting a subject’s genetic material under controlled conditions and then reinjecting them, as seen in some research-based therapies for hereditary blood ailments and immunodeficiencies.
The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has dramatically improved gene therapy research, allowing for precise modifications at the genetic scale.
